Six Flags Entertainment Corp., North America’s largest regional amusement park operator, will host spring Grad Nite events in major cities nationwide, offering celebrations for graduating middle and high school students.
In Southern California, Knott’s Berry Farm and Six Flags Magic Mountain will participate with both senior and junior Grad Nite events. The private, after-hours celebrations give students an opportunity to celebrate academic achievements with friends in amusement parks reserved exclusively for their schools.
Grad Nite events feature dance parties, dining, games and access to select rides, creating experiences close to home that are more affordable than destination graduation trips.

2026 Grad Nite schedule
Knott’s Berry Farm, Buena Park, Calif. — New for 2026
Junior Grad Nite: Thursday, May 14
Senior Grad Nite: Thursday, May 28
Six Flags Magic Mountain, Valencia, Calif.
Junior Grad Nite: May 8 and May 22
Senior Grad Nite: May 15 and May 29
